About The Team

The Services Engineering team, part of Visa’s O&I entities, supports service delivery for Spend Clarity for Enterprises (SCE). We focus on fulfilling infrastructure and platform requests, streamlining processes, and driving automation. Our mission is to ensure exceptional services, optimal product functionality, and increased operational efficiency.

What You’Ll Do

  • Fulfil infrastructure and SCE platform service requests from the standard service catalogue
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to improve request workflows
  • Identify and help reduce repetitive tasks through automation
  • Support migration projects and contribute to process improvements
  • Contribute to GenAI initiatives aimed at enhancing operational efficiency and service delivery.
